keysborough secondary college teacher kim ramchen faces court over alleged principal stabbing.

a 37-year-old teacher allegedly stabbed the principal of Keysborough Secondary College, Melbourne, on Tuesday, 3 December 2025. The principal sustained non-life-threatening injuries to his arm and face. The school went into lockdown during the incident, and the teacher was arrested at the scene.

​

staff and students have been offered wellbeing support following the attack.
